Follow three quick steps to connect or read additional resources from LiftMaster.The following process will restore a LiftMaster MyQ Internet Gateway (828LM) to its factory default settings. Any doors or equipment enrolled in the gateway will be deleted, so they will need to be relearned after the factory reset is completed. If you forget the code for your LiftMaster garage door opener keypad, follow these steps to reset it: 1) Locate the “Learn” button on the opener. 2) Press and release the “Learn” button, then wait for the indicator light to turn on. 3) Within 30 seconds, enter a new four-digit code on the keypad.

When a factory reset is performed, ALL remote controls and keyless entry codes are erased from the garage door opener. The remotes and keyless entry will need to be reprogrammed.
